WebApr 20, 2015 · Emory Douglas, one of the five artists honored as a 2015 AIGA Medalist, spurred civil rights education and reform through his design work. A revolutionary artist and minister of culture for the Black Panthers from 1967 to the early 1980s, Douglas’ work came to exemplify the Black Power movement. WebMar 20, 2013 · Emory Douglas (born May 24, 1943 in Grand Rapids, Michigan) worked as the Minister of Culture for the Black Panther Party from 1967 until the Party disbanded in the 1980s.
